Booking a flight at the right time can save travelers hundreds of dollars, and research has shown that Tuesday is often the best day to find cheaper fares. Airlines typically release sales and promotions on Monday evenings, which means that by Tuesday morning, other airlines have adjusted their prices to compete. This makes Tuesday a prime day for booking flights.

However, travelers should also consider other factors, such as the time of year and the day of the week they plan to fly.Although booking on a Tuesday can help save money, flexibility in travel dates is one of the best ways to secure a good deal. Flights on weekdays, especially Tuesdays and Wednesdays, are often cheaper than flights on weekends. Additionally, booking flights during off-peak seasons can also lead to significant savings. Many travel apps and websites allow users to set price alerts, which notify them when ticket prices drop. These strategies combined can make air travel more affordable.
